IBM Support

PH41118: DFHME0121 ATTEMPT AT FORMATTING MESSAGE DFHPI0997 FAILED - INVALID DBCS FORMAT DUMP PRODUCED

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• Your CICS region issues the following messages:
    
    DFHME0121 applid The first attempt at formatting message
              DFHPI0997, TD queue CPIO, has failed -
              Invalid DBCS format
    DFHDU0201 CIPREO05 ABOUT TO TAKE SDUMP. DUMPCODE: ME0121
    
    The dump showed the following exception trace entries:
      PI 0A27 PIIS *EXC* - TRANSPORT_FAILED -
    
      ME FF37 MEFO *EXC* - INVALID-FORMAT
    
    Module DFHPIPM2 is processing an error-
       msg_target_program_unavailable
    causing it to attempt to put out message:
    
    DFHPI0997 date time applid tranid PIPELINE pipename
              WEBSERVICE webservice
              The CICS pipeline manager has encountered an error:
              target program unavailable or abended.
    
    There is a bug in DFHPIPM2 where it references the web service
    name from the Pipeline instance or PIIS block after it has been
    freed.
    In this case the storage had been reused, causing the web
    service name to contain shift out character - x'0F', making
    the message module think it was dealing with DBCS characters.
    
    Additional symptoms: KIXREVRJL
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All CICS users.                              *
    ****************************************************************
    * PROBLEM DESCRIPTION: Message DFHME0121 reports an invalid    *
    *                      DBCS format within message DFHPI0997.   *
    ****************************************************************
    CICS is acting as a web services provider and encounters an
    error while processing a request. The PIIS pipeline instance
    data is freed and the storage is reused.
    
    Message DFHPI0997 is issued with an insert taken from the
    storage location that previously held the PIIS webService_name
    field.
    
    Message DFHME0121 is then issued because the data in the insert
    contains the DBCS shift in (SI) character x'0F'.
    

Problem conclusion

  • CICS is changed so it does not use webService_name as the source
    of the DFHPI0997 webservice insert if the PIIS has been freed.
    

Temporary fix

Comments

APAR Information

  • APAR number

    PH41118

  • Reported component name

    CICS TS Z/OS V5

  • Reported component ID

    5655Y0400

  • Reported release

    200

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2021-10-05

  • Closed date

    2022-01-21

  • Last modified date

    2022-02-01

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    UI79004 UI79005

Modules/Macros

  • DFHPIPM  DFHPIPM2
    

Fix information

  • Fixed component name

    CICS TS Z/OS V5

  • Fixed component ID

    5655Y0400

Applicable component levels

  • R200 PSY UI79005

       UP22/01/22 P F201

  • R300 PSY UI79004

       UP22/01/22 P F201

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Line of Business":{"code":"LOB35","label":"Mainframe SW"},"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GMGV","label":"CICS Transaction Server"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"5.5"}]

Document Information

Modified date:
02 February 2022